Best Quotes about Thoughts and thinking

1.
Nurture your mind with great thoughts, for you will never go any higher than you think.
Disraeli, Benjamin

2.
Sooner or later, false thinking brings wrong conduct.
Huxley, Julian S.

3.
Tell your boss what you think of him and the truth shall set you free.

4.
Kind thoughts are rarer than either kind words or deeds. They imply a great deal of thinking about others. This in itself is rare. But they also imply a great deal of thinking about others without the thoughts being criticisms. This is rarer still.
Faber, Frederick W.

5.
Everyone has to learn to think differently, bigger, to open to possibilities.
Winfrey, Oprah

6.
In America we can say what we think, and even if we can't think, we can say it anyhow.
Kettering, Charles F.

7.
If one wants to abide in the thought-free state, a struggle is inevitable. One must fight one's way through before regaining one's original primal state. If one succeeds in the fight and reaches the goal, the enemy, namely the thoughts, will all subside in the Self and disappear entirely.
Maharshi, Ramana

8.
As you think, so shall you become.
Lee, Bruce

9.
Our virtues are dearer to us the more we have had to suffer for them. It is the same with our children. All profound affection entertains a sacrifice. Our thoughts are often worse than we are, just as they are often better.
Eliot, George

10.
Every thought you entertain is a force that goes out, and every thought comes back laden with its kind.
Trine, Ralph Waldo

11.
THINK. Think about your appearance, associations, actions, ambitions, accomplishment.
Watson, Thomas J.

12.
Thinking in words slows you down and actually decreases comprehension in much the same way as walking a tightrope too slowly makes one lose one's balance.
Fleischer, Lenore

13.
Thought is the sculptor who can create the person you want to be.
Thoreau, Henry David

14.
What's going on in the inside shows on the outside.
Nightingale, Earl

15.
There is no thought in any mind, but it quickly tends to convert itself into power.
Emerson, Ralph Waldo

16.
No man can think clearly when his fists are clenched.
Nathan, George Jean

17.
We do not live to think, but, on the contrary, we think in order that we may succeed in surviving.
Gasset, Jose Ortega Y

18.
Thoughts are forces.
Trine, Ralph Waldo

19.
The soul of God is poured into the world through the thoughts of men.
Emerson, Ralph Waldo

20.
Learn to think like a winner. Think positive and visualize your strengths.
Braden, Vic

21.
I roamed the countryside searching for answers to things I did not understand. Why thunder lasts longer than that which causes it, and why immediately on its creation the lightning becomes visible to the eye while thunder requires time to travel. How the various circles of water form around the spot which has been struck by a stone and why a bird sustains itself in the air. These questions and other strange phenomena engaged my thought throughout my life.
Da Vinci, Leonardo

22.
The minute a phrase, becomes current, it becomes an apology for not thinking accurately to the end of the sentence.
Holmes, Oliver Wendell

23.
Thought expands, but paralyzes; action animates, but narrows.
Goethe, Johann Wolfgang Von

24.
Thought makes every thing fit for use.
Emerson, Ralph Waldo

25.
Man is only a reed, the weakest in nature; but he is a thinking reed. There is no need for the whole universe to take up arms to crush him: a vapor, a drop of water is enough to kill him. But even if the universe were to crush him, man would still be nobler than his slayer, because he knows that he is dying and the advantage the universe has over him. The universe knows nothing of this.
Pascal, Blaise

26.
If we are not ashamed to think it, we should not be ashamed to say it.
Cicero, Marcus T.

27.
The birth of thought in the depths of the spirit, the shaping and ordering of it into periods, the translation into signs, and above all the transference of it from one spirit to another, the communication that is, if only for an instant, the meeting of two beings, with the unforeseeable consequences that such a meeting always causes, is in fact a miracle; except that the moment one stops to think about it one can't even write a letter.
Satta, Salvatore

28.
A person may dwell so long upon a thought that it may take him a prisoner.
Halifax, Edward F.

29.
Few people think more than two or three times a year. I have made an international reputation for myself thinking once or twice a week.
Shaw, George Bernard

30.
The birthplace of success for each person is in his Inner-Consciousness. The Inner-Consciousness will use whatever it is given. If constructive thoughts are planted positive outcomes will be the result. Plant the seeds of failure and failure will follow.
Madwed, Sidney

31.
You live with your thoughts -- so be careful what they are.
Arrington, Eva

32.
Thought is the labor of the intellect, reverie is its pleasure.
Hugo, Victor

33.
It was at a particular moment in the history of my own rages that I saw the Western world conditioned by the images of Marx, Darwin and Freud; and Marx, Darwin and Freud are the three most crashing bores of the Western world. The simplistic popularization of their ideas has thrust our world into a mental straitjacket from which we can only escape by the most anarchic violence.
Golding, William

34.
It is clear that all verbal structures with meaning are verbal imitations of that elusive psychological and physiological process known as thought, a process stumbling through emotional entanglements, sudden irrational convictions, involuntary gleams of insight, rationalized prejudices, and blocks of panic and inertia, finally to reach a completely incommunicable intuition.
Frye, Northrop

35.
One thought fills immensity.
Blake, William

36.
I think I did pretty well, considering I started out with nothing but a bunch of blank paper.
Martin, Steve

37.
If everybody thought before they spoke, the silence would be deafening.
Barzan, George

38.
We are what we think. All that we are arises With our thoughts. With our thoughts, We make our world.
Buddha

39.
Clarity is the counterbalance of profound thoughts.
Vauvenargues, Marquis De

40.
Some people study all their life, and at death they have learned everything except how to think.

41.
The more we are filled with thoughts of lust the less we find true romantic love.
Horton, Doug

42.
Life is good when we think it's good. Life is bad when we don't think.
Horton, Doug

43.
Thought precedes action, action does not always precede thought.
Horton, Doug

44.
A hundred wagon loads of thoughts will not pay a single ounce of debt.
Proverb, Italian

45.
We shall require a substantially new manner of thinking if mankind is to survive.
Einstein, Albert

46.
Man is the only creature who has a nasty mind.
Twain, Mark

47.
Modern man likes to pretend that his thinking is wide-awake. But this wide-awake thinking has led us into the mazes of a nightmare in which the torture chambers are endlessly repeated in the mirrors of reason.
Paz, Octavio

48.
A thought which does not result in an action is nothing much, and an action which does not proceed from a thought is nothing at all.
Bernanos, Georges

49.
It's only a thought, and a thought can be changed.
May, Louise

50.
Thought is the wind and knowledge the sail.
Hare, David
